What they do

A Radiologic Technician or Technologist operates X Ray, MRI (Magnetic Resonance Imaging) or CT (Computed Tomography) scan equipment to take diagnostic images of a patient. Works with doctors to obtain specific images necessary for medical diagnosis.

Candidates MUST have at least 1 year of experience (2 years preferred) and have an active, Non-Certified Radiological Technician (NCRT) permit with the Texas Medical Board and Medical Assistant Certification. Candidates need to be punctual, dependable and be able to communicate effectively with patients and staff. Primary Job Duties (include but not limited to): Greet patients in waiting area, assure patient flow runs smoothly and efficiently, escort patients to discharge counter. Obtain patient history; assess/triage patient and record information on chart. Start/monitor IV, blood draw, perform CLIA-waived lab tests and assist provider with any procedures. Remove sutures/staples and change sterile and non-sterile dressings. Performs timely and quality radiology procedures for subsequent evaluation and treatment by provider. Monitor disposable inventory and place orders for medical supplies and pharmaceuticals. Perform quality checks on medical equipment. Assist registration staff and perform additional clerical duties as necessary.
